From 5a31afdd0ca3db44209ec1348999af2285373de1 Mon Sep 17 00:00:00 2001 From: Ben Pfaff Date: Thu, 7 Aug 2008 11:46:22 -0700 Subject: [PATCH] Don't call kfree_skb() with interrupts disabled. Freeing an skb that has a destructor may require interrupts to be enabled. This can happen when netfilter is performing NAT, for example.
